A radically different ship to its regular Scorpion counterpart, the Scorpion Navy Issue (commonly abbreviated CNS) is a combat-oriented missile boat, with more in common with a Raven than a Scorpion. The Navy Scorpion and Navy Raven are similar ships and are often compared.
